BronxRik Posted March 4, 2013 Share Posted March 4, 2013 Joe Flacco's six-year contract with the Baltimore Ravens is worth $120.6 million, two sources who've seen the contract told NFL.com's Albert Breer on Sunday night. NFL.com's Ian Rapoport and Breer reported the deal also has been finalized, according to Flacco's agent Joe Linta. The one remaining detail that Flacco's agent and the Ravens need to work out Monday deals with marketing related to the contract. However, the issue is expected to be resolved quickly, Breer reported. Flacco's new contract includes $52 million in guaranteed money and the quarterback will also receive a $29 million signing bonus. Here's a breakdown of Flacco's new contract, the richest in NFL history: » $6.8 million salary-cap number in Year 1 » $29 million cap number in Year 4 » $30 million in Year 1 » $51 million through Year 2 » $62 million through Year 3 » $80 million through Year 4 » $100.6 million through Year 5 Option bonuses of $15 million and $7 million are also part of the contract. Ravens coach John Harbaugh texted the following reaction to Breer: "Just very happy for Joe, his family, and also for Ravens fans. He always been our QB. So to me, this is very fitting." Flacco's teammate, linebacker Terrell Suggs, left no doubt about his feelings: His text to Breer consisted of one word: "AWESOME!!!!!!!!!!!" New Orleans Saints quarterback Drew Brees previously held the distinction of NFL's highest-paid player with a five-year, $100 million contract, including $60 million guaranteed, signed last year. http://www.nfl.com/n...ized-agent-says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
